Extreme Heat Risks Higher for Affordable Housing Residents: Market and Social Impacts
Affordable housing residents often live in older buildings that lack modern insulation, energy-efficient cooling systems, or shade-providing landscaping. According to the U.S. Department of Housing and Urban Development (HUD), more than 70% of subsidized housing units were constructed before 1980, long before current cooling and sustainability standards. As a result, these properties are significantly less equipped to shield occupants from unprecedented heatwaves, intensifying the overall extreme heat risks higher for affordable housing residents.
This exposure has a direct effect on energy consumption and costs. Families facing high utility bills are less able to afford air conditioning and can suffer health consequences including heat stroke, dehydration, and exacerbated respiratory conditions. The Centers for Disease Control and Prevention identifies low-income individuals as disproportionately affected during heat emergencies, which is exacerbated for affordable housing communities.
Investor Considerations: Real Estate Risk and Resilience
For real estate investors and asset managers, the growing evidence that climate risk impacts portfolios cannot be ignored. Properties facing chronic heat exposure risk both decreased value and higher insurance premiums. Furthermore, municipalities are increasingly adopting building codes mandating heat mitigation features such as reflective roofing, improved ventilation, and energy-efficient systems — which will raise compliance costs for property owners who haven’t proactively upgraded their assets.
Investors looking to safeguard long-term returns must assess the resiliency of affordable housing properties in at-risk regions. Retrofitting older units with heat-resistant materials or energy-efficient infrastructure like heat pumps and insulated windows not only protects residents but preserves asset value. Moreover, demonstrating proactive compliance with evolving sustainability benchmarks can be an advantage in securing public or private funding grants.
Community Health and Financial Implications of Extreme Heat
The public health ramifications of extreme heat are profound and closely linked to affordable housing. A 2023 study from the Urban Institute found that individuals in low-income housing are twice as likely to suffer heat-related health incidents compared to those in market-rate or luxury developments. Poor indoor air quality, unreliable cooling, and overcrowding further amplify these dangers.
Consequently, medical emergencies arising from extreme heat can lead to higher municipal healthcare expenditures and lost productivity. For landlords and local governments, these outcomes translate to reputational risks, increased tenant turnover, and legal liabilities. Investors should expect growing pressure from residents, advocacy groups, and regulators demanding climate-adaptive upgrades for affordable housing units.
Policy Developments and Funding Opportunities
Federal and local governments are responding to this growing crisis. In 2024, the Inflation Reduction Act and the Department of Energy launched grant programs focused on improving energy efficiency in low-income housing. These incentives offer a pathway for investors and developers to modernize housing stock while lowering capital outlays. By leveraging these public funding sources, affordable housing stakeholders can bolster resilience and potentially enhance sustainable investment returns.
Internationally, cities such as Paris and Tokyo are also introducing heat mapping and green infrastructure upgrades targeting the most vulnerable residential zones. Such initiatives are likely to set benchmarks for U.S. municipalities seeking to minimize the health and economic toll of extreme heat events.
